Wabash Rally Falls Short in Home Loss To Wooster

Wabash fell behind 14-0 in the opening four minutes of Saturday's North Coast Athletic Conference home game versus the College of Wooster before rallying to lead with two minutes remaining in the game. The Little Giants' efforts fell short in the end, losing to the Fighting Scots 80-72.
 
Wabash (8-9, 4-6 NCAC) missed its first 11 shots from the field to face a 14-0 deficit before Conner Brens broke the ice for the Little Giants with a layup. Wabash eventually trailed 21-5 before mounting its first big scoring run. The Little Giants scored the next 13 points while holding the Scots (13-4, 7-3 NCAC) scoreless for four minutes to trim the lead to 21-18.
 
Wooster held a 39-34 lead at the half, holding the lead through the opening four minutes of the second period. Wabash cut into the visitor's advantage until Jack Davidson nailed a three-point shot at the 16:20 mark of the half to put the Little Giants in front 42-40. The lead jumped back and forth over the next three minutes until Wooster regained the lead on a basket from Reece Dupler to put the Scots in front 50-48.
 
Wooster extended its advantage to 11 points at 61-50 with 9:50 remaining. The Little Giants mounted another rally, beginning with a three-point play from Davidson on a drive to the basket and a free throw. Brens took control in the paint, scoring two more of his season-high 13 points to cut the Wooster lead to six. The Little Giants continued to cut into the Scots' advantage until Brens hit another shot in close and added a free throw to make it a one-point contest at 63-62 with 5:57 left to play.
 
Wooster answered with back-to-back three-point baskets from Blake Blair and Dupler to move back up by seven. Brens responded with another basket, followed by a Connor Rotterman triple for a 69-67 two-point deficit for the Little Giants. Two free throws from Davidson came after a layup by Dupler to keep Wabash within two.
 
Davidson brought the Wabash crowd to its feet with a pull-up three-pointer with 2:35 remaining to provide the Little Giants a 72-71 lead. Those would be the final points of the game for Wabash. Wooster tallied the final nine points down the stretch to take the eight-point victory.
 
Rotterman kept the Little Giants in the game in the first half, coming off the bench to score 17 points in the opening period. He finished with a team-best 20 points. Brens and Davidson each scored 13 points. Alex Eberhard added 10 points.
 
Dupler paced Wooster with 20 points. Spencer Williams and Trenton Tipton each scored 15 points for the Scots. Dayon Hempy finished with 14 points.
